Wouldn’t it be great if you could uncover a fact about someone that they hadn’t yet divulged to a living soul, and then use this information to enrich their life?

This is exactly what Milton Erickson regularly did. He was renowned for making unbelievable – yet accurate – predictions about people.

He once astounded a doctor colleague of his by congratulating her on her pregnancy.

This sounds all perfectly normal, you might be thinking.

But where things venture into the unusual is due to the fact that she had literally only just discovered that she was pregnant. She was yet to reveal the exciting news to anyone.

So how did he do this? Not even the baby’s father was aware of the pregnancy at this stage.

Although Erickson’s insight seemed like magic, he had, in fact, simply used his powers of observation.

And no, it wasn’t because she was showing either – as there was no obvious baby bump in sight.

However, he did happen to know about a condition known as Chloasma. This can develop in some pregnant women and causes a mark (not dissimilar to skin pigmentation) to appear their forehead. This is also sometimes known as the “mask of pregnancy.”

So rather than having some magical power, Erickson had observed that his colleague’s forehead bore this mark, so after presuming that she was pregnant, he congratulated her (while obviously astounding her in the process).

What Is Hypnotic Mind Reading And How Does It Work?

For hypnotists, language is all-important and the words you use can either help or hinder you.

Hypnotic Mind Reading is a way of distracting and engaging your listeners by exploiting the vagueness that’s built-in to language.

It’s important to be aware of the ways in which Hypnotic Mind Reading differs from Psychological Mind Reading.

Hypnotic Mind Reading should always be used to enrich someone’s life and be based on observations you make about a person. It should never be based on lies or deception!

But when used ethically, Hypnotic Mind Reading is an absolute killer way to bypass the critical factor – helping you to access a subject’s unconscious mind and get to work with helping them overcome whatever issue they’ve come to you for.

Meaning this technique is very effective when working with resistant subjects. But we can’t reiterate enough – using this kind of technique is only warranted when you have the intention of actually helping a subject. It should never be used for your own or someone else’s benefit.

Basically, it goes back to hypnosis ethics 101 where you only use this powerful skill to be a force for good in the world.

Psychological Mind Reading, on the other hand, is generally used for entertainment and is designed to be deceptive.

In Astrology, for example, a study was carried out in which a number of subjects were each given a written astrology reading. The text on each of the readings was identical, with only the birthdays in the headings altered.

Remarkably, everyone who took part rated the accuracy of their reading at above 90%! This is a prime example of how astrologists (not all of course, but some) use techniques to “read minds” and deceive people.

And to follow on from this example here’s something else for you to ponder on… often these kinds of readings act as hypnotic suggestions. Yep, really.

When you think about it, it makes sense. Because regardless of whether a subject’s reading is made up or based on some form of intuition or foresight  – if the subject feels this person has a gift due to what they’ve perceived, it has the power to become a hypnotic suggestion. The 4 Hypnotic Profiles And How To Use Them

4 hypnotic profiles how to use them

At this point, it’s worth noting that Hypnotic Profiles, or Elements, can be invaluable when using Hypnotic Mind Reading techniques.

It’s important to remember, though, that a person’s profile will change depending on their circumstances and mental state – so it’s worthwhile bearing this in mind.

But to help identify the main profiles, there are certain clues you can look out for – which can be simplified by taking notice of the two main polarities.

By looking out for these, you can often make very accurate educated guesses as to how a the subject will behave and what kind of language they are most likely to respond to.

These two polarities are:

Abstractly vs. Concrete Thinking

The concrete thinker will usually have a lot to say for themselves and will focus on the specifics of what they are saying, using facts and figures and giving lots of detail, such as: “The house next door” or “My postman, Jim.”

A person who thinks abstractly, on the other hand, is likely to be more purposeful in their conversations, while speaking less and using generalisations more. Such as using: “houses’ or “postmen,” in more general terms than a concrete thinker.

Left Brain vs. Right Brain

It is common knowledge that different parts of the brain perform differently tasks. In addition to this, people with different characteristics can be identified by which half, or hemisphere, of their brain is most dominant.

For example, those who are right-brain dominant, tend to be more intuitive, spontaneous, and emotional, using language, like: “I sense,” “I feel” and so on. Whereas those with left-brain dominance tend to be more analytical – having a natural leaning towards maths and science.

It is important to be aware that the left and right hemispheres of the brain work together. So while left or right brain dominance can be an indication of a person’s characteristics, there will be blends of both to varying degrees.

In addition to the above polarities, subjects can be further divided into 4 hypnotic profiles or elements. The characteristics of these elements can also help you to connect with a subject’s unconscious through Hypnotic Mind Reading.

1. Earth Profile

These people tend to be concrete and left brain thinkers, firmly rooted in logic. They will be very methodical with great attention to detail – their feet planted firmly on the ground.

2. Fire Profile

In this case, people are concrete and right-brained thinkers. Although they are also firmly rooted, they tend to look for the joy of experience in the senses and are adept at “living in the moment.”

3. Air Profile

People who fit into this category tend to be abstract and left brain thinking and are more prone to ideology than sensual experience. They tend to appear rather aloof, due to distancing themselves from the day-to-day world.

4. Water Profile

Water profile people are abstract and right brain thinkers which makes them more intuitive and more readily in touch with the deeper meanings of life.

Having established which of these 4 elements your subject belongs to, you can use this information to closely align with their situation and help build rapport.

5 Hypnotic Mind Reading Techniques So You Can Be A Force For Positive Change

1.The Delayed Echo

People like talking about themselves, and when they do they pass on information. Like where they’ve been on holiday, where they’re from, names of family members. They mention these things in passing, and your job is to pay attention. Here’s what you need to do:

  • Remember the facts
  • Don’t draw attention to the information
  • Immediately start talking about something else
  • Wait 5 minutes until they forget what they’ve told you
  • Start mentioning the holiday/family member using different words or phrases from those used by the person

As you can see, the idea is to echo the facts – using different language – so they think you somehow “picked up” on it.

2. Pure Flattery

It’s flattering to people when you apparently “perceive” their inner qualities. The things you say might not be strictly accurate, but they’ll be traits that most people tend to identify with.

However, it’s important to only use flattery that is based on truth, so the subject you are working with is most likely to believe you. It’s also important to note that the examples given here are based on Western culture and that you should use your discretion when working with people from different cultures as to what may or may not be acceptable to them.

For example, here are some general traits that are effective with anyone of either sex:

  • Hard working
  • Friendly
  • Reliable
  • Loyal
  • Honest
  • Smart
  • Positive
  • Resourceful

If the person is female, you could say they are:

  • Sensitive
  • Perceptive
  • Intuitive
  • Helpful
  • Underappreciated

If they’re male, you might describe them as:

  • Confident
  • Independent
  • Practical
  • Rational
  • Good at problem solving

3. CAP (Covering All Possibilities)

This follows on from the previous technique, but instead of picking out one trait, you focus on two opposing qualities.

Firstly, the positive (helpful) and then the negative (impatient) qualities are highlighted. Once again, you need to stick to generalities rather than using quantifiable facts.

For example:

“You’re someone who likes to help others, but at times you can get impatient.”

As you can see, this might apply to anybody. The person will accept it because it shows them in a positive light first. To soften the edge of the negative trait, it might help to add some humor.

“You’re a very helpful person, but I wouldn’t want to be on the receiving end when your patience runs out!”

4. The Barnum

Named after PT Barnum of circus fame, this technique uses a statement that’s very specific on the one hand, but that could be true of almost anyone.

Start with a general statement, watch for a reaction, and then move into specifics. Use their reaction to your general statement as a guide to which direction you should go in. Here’s an example when the reaction is positive:

“You’re a positive person – [watch for reaction] – when things go wrong you always find the positives in the situation. You see opportunities and make the best of things.”

And here’s an example when the reaction is negative:

“You’re quite a dreamer –  [watch for reaction] – but you never let dreams get in the way of your practical side. Everything you do is rooted in reality.”

This technique uses flattery and also covers all possibilities. Try to use some negative traits so that your “reading” doesn’t come across as sycophantic or even improbable:

“You can be very hard on yourself.”

“You’re able to bear a grudge for a long time.”

“There are things in your past that you regret having done.”

5. Universal Experiences

Also called the 7 Ages of Man, this technique relies on experiences everybody has at different stages throughout their lives.

While they aren’t written in stone, they can give you an idea about what people are experiencing, based on their age.

It’s important to note that these examples mainly apply to Western culture, so again, you will need to use your discretion accordingly when working with other cultures.

And in some instances, some of them may be considered slightly outdated in Western culture (just ask any millennial!), so these age brackets are broad descriptions of what a person is likely to be experiencing – but not always.
